What Defines Cork Stripe Storage Jars?

If you buy good glass jars with cork accents or artsy cork stripes on the lids, cork stripe storage jars are easier to hold and look better. These jars' cork comes from cork oak trees that can grow back. That being said, this is an eco-friendly choice because it doesn't hurt the trees. Most of these jars can hold between 800ml and 1000ml, so you can put different things in them, like coffee beans, dry grains, or general food items. The Japanese-style simple design is made up of clean glass lines and warm cork tones. It has a warm look that shops want to draw careful shoppers.

What Makes Bamboo Lid Storage Jars Stand Out?

One of the best things about bamboo lid storage jars is that they are strong and good for the environment. The bamboo grows quickly and doesn't need many resources, so these jars are a beautiful and eco-friendly way to package things. Most of the time, food-grade rubber rings on the lids keep air, moisture, and rust out. This great design is great for businesses that need to store food and keep it fresh for a long time. Modern kitchens feel warmer and more natural when bamboo's natural grain designs are used. These designs also support brand stories about healthy and natural living.

Performance and Usability Comparison

Durability and Material Resilience

When it comes to protecting against damage, bamboo lids are better than cork stripe storage jar. Even after being opened and closed many times, they still have the same structure. In business kitchens where tools will touch each other, bamboo wood is strong enough to handle being used because it is thick and hard. Materials made of cork should last a long time, but they might start to wear out after a while if you live somewhere wet. This is because cork can soak up water from the air. The two kinds of jars are both made of glass, which doesn't respond with chemicals or heat quickly. That means the things inside will always be clean, no matter how long they are kept.

Seal Integrity and Freshness Preservation

Storage jars with bamboo lids keep air out better than ones with cork stripes because they are made with silicone bands that make vacuum-level seals. When the humidity is controlled, tests in the lab show that jars with bamboo lids keep moisture barrier rates below 0.1g per day. In this way, fragile things like dried plants or gourmet coffee beans don't break. Cork lids with compression fit systems make a good seal for things that need some air flow, but they're not great for keeping strong aromatics for a long time. This difference is very important for brands that tell people their products are fresh.

Maintenance and Care Requirements

Heat processes in a dishwasher can damage cork over time, so you should wash cork lids by hand to keep their shape. There are also gentle ways to clean bamboo lids, but high-quality treatments for bamboo keep it from collecting water better than raw bamboo. The glass bottoms of both systems can be cleaned in commercial dishwashers, which makes it easy to clean in places that serve food. How Effective Are Cork Stripe Jars for Maintaining Product Freshness?

The compression-fit lids on cork-stripe storage jars keep air out to a moderate degree, making them suitable for dry goods that don't require hermetically sealed packaging, such as whole grains, pasta, or baking ingredients. They're good for foods that you'll eat in a few weeks, but they might not be able to keep sensitive foods like spices or ground coffee from going bad for a long time.

Can Bamboo Lids Withstand Commercial Dishwasher Environments?

A professional machine can clean the bodies of glass jars, but bamboo lids need to be washed by hand so they don't twist and the seal doesn't break. Some processes, like carbonization, make high-quality bamboo more resistant to water. However, putting the lid through high-heat steam cycles over and over again shortens its life and makes the seal weaker.
